Output abe17031eca46894db67f245ce2c5223ac90ef215140ddc9e3eb14edfd095dfa:1

value
81809
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 570573ab86b2d1debc1cf8f4d99de53e6e11e955 OP_EQUALVERIFY OP_CHECKSIG
address
18w8KVPXWFSm64dvjh4vHahR71ksM3hVxL
transaction
abe17031eca46894db67f245ce2c5223ac90ef215140ddc9e3eb14edfd095dfa
confirmations
429212
spent
true